Ways of Coping Questionnaire.
WOC / WCQ
- What it measures
- Situational coping (thoughts/actions used for a specific stressful encounter) across 8 scales: confrontive coping, distancing, self-controlling, seeking social support, accepting responsibility, escape-avoidance, planful problem-solving, positive reappraisal
- Length and format
- 66 (50 scored). 4-point Likert (0-3) frequency of use for a named stressor (self-report questionnaire)
- Language versions
- Many languages internationally
